In astrology, Horary Astrology is a traditional method in which a chart is calculated for the time and place at which a clearly defined question is asked or formally received by the astrologer. Rather than beginning with a person’s birth chart, horary practice interprets the resulting chart in relation to the subject of the question. Particular houses, planetary rulers, aspects, dignities, and other chart conditions may be used to represent the people, circumstances, and relationships involved. Horary Astrology has a long history within Western astrological traditions and employs specialized interpretive rules that differ from ordinary natal-chart interpretation. Its conclusions are interpretive within an astrological framework and should not substitute for professional, legal, medical, financial, or other high-stakes advice.
